Andriuth Peña

3×3 · top 10.0% of 284,439 all-time · competing since June 2014 · 2014PENA03

Andriuth Peña has been competing for 12 years. His best event is the 3×3: a personal-best single of 10.85, set at Latin America Cubing Tour - Chía 2017, puts him in the top 10.0% of the 284,439 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 96th in Venezuela. Across 24 competitions since June 2014, he has put 854 official solves on the record across ten events. Solve to solve, his 3×3 times vary about 13% around a typical one; 53% of the 35,811 competitors with ten or more counted rounds hold a tighter spread. His 3×3 best has come down from 38.07 in June 2014 to 10.85, a 71% improvement. Andriuth has entered 24 competitions, more competitions than 97% of everyone who has ever competed.
